Yoga to Improve Mental and Physical Health
Incorporating
yoga into your daily routine can bring a ton of benefits for both your mental
and physical health. Here are some key advantages:
1. Improves
Flexibility and Strength: Regular yoga practice stretches and tones the body
muscles and makes them strong. It also helps improve your posture when you
stand, sit, sleep, or walk.
2. Reduces
Stress and Anxiety: Yoga involves breathing exercises and meditation, which can
help reduce stress and promote relaxation. It encourages a calm and focused
mind, which can help manage anxiety.
3. Enhances
Mental Clarity and Concentration: The meditative aspects of yoga help to
improve focus and mental clarity. This can lead to better decision-making
skills and a more organized thought process.
4. Boosts
Immunity: Yoga poses and breathing techniques can improve the functioning of
the immune system, helping the body fight off illnesses more effectively.
5. Promotes
Better Sleep: Engaging in yoga before bedtime can help you relax and prepare
for a good night's sleep. It can improve the quality and duration of sleep.
6.
Increases Energy Levels: Regular yoga practice can boost your energy levels and
keep you feeling fresh throughout the day.
7. Supports
Heart Health: Yoga can help lower blood pressure, and cholesterol levels, and
reduce the risk of heart disease.
8.
Encourages Mindfulness: Yoga promotes mindfulness, which is the practice of
being present in the moment. This can lead to increased self-awareness and a
greater appreciation for life.
By incorporating yoga into
your daily routine, you can create a holistic approach to maintaining both your
